10000 Watts to Amps Calculator (10kW to Amps) Benchmark Lookup Table
| Supply Voltage | Phase Configuration | Current (10 kW) | Recommended Breaker |
|---|---|---|---|
| 120V AC | Single-Phase | 83.33 Amps | 110 A Breaker |
| 208V AC | Single-Phase | 48.08 Amps | 60 A Breaker |
| 208V AC | Three-Phase | 32.66 Amps | 45 A Breaker |
| 240V AC | Single-Phase | 41.67 Amps | 60 A Breaker |
| 480V AC | Three-Phase | 14.15 Amps | 20 A Breaker |
